This program is divided into two branches - the medical Treatment Program and the active Rehabilitation Program. Clients may attend either one or both branches of the program. He or she may be referred directly from the Initial Assessment or may have been discharged from the Inpatient or Day Programs and require follow-up support.

Medical Treatment Program

The medical Treatment Program is designed for patients who require ongoing medical management of their pain. The patient will either see a medical internist, psychiatrist, anesthesiologist, or all three depending on his or her needs. All appointments with physicians are followed up with a report to the referral source.

Active Rehabilitation Program

The active Rehabilitation Program is for patients who require either occupational therapy, physiotherapy, or psychology, or all three. The patients attend on an outpatient basis and work with a therapist individually. This is a dynamic program, requiring active patient participation. The program is designed to optimize a patient’s physical and emotional function. Therapists work closely with the referral source and reports are available upon request.
